Models Covered & Key Technical Specifications
1996-1999 Buick LeSabre Shop Manual For all 1996-1999 Buick LeSabre models: diagnostics, service, and parts information, including detailed diagrams and procedures. Publication C4085-91017.
- System Specifications: 3.8L V6 Displacement is specified as 3800 cc for engine performance.
- Maximum Dimensions: For critical measurement, 236 mm establishes the maximum rear suspension trim height.
- Measured Tolerances: Tolerances require adherence to 19 mm side-to-side variation for proper suspension alignment.
- Critical Capacities: The fuel load simulates approximately 3.75 liters for rear suspension loading.
- Universal Component Data: All LeSabre models feature a standard body code "H" for identification.
- Technical Specifications: The ABS system utilizes a Delco Bosch 5 brake system for comprehensive control.
